About

Manage your 3D printing filament inventory with ease. This app allows you to track spools, scan barcodes for quick identification, and filter your stock to find the right material instantly.

Filament inventory management
Barcode scanning
Smart filtering by availability, color, and type
Organize filament spools
Track stock levels

User reviews

This app needs more work

Not to be completely negative but the app needs more work.
-Manufacturers aren’t alphabetized
-There needs to be a filament type field (ie. silk, rapid, matte, etc)
-Name field is unnecessary, if all the information is in the various drop downs then the name is unneeded. I just put a single blank space to make it accept a new filament.
-The color matching is great, it recognizes color hex codes which is cool, but how am I supposed to enter multicolor filaments?
-I added materials to the material list but it won’t accept the material when I select if for a new filament.
-How exactly is the in stock, out of stock supposed to work? It’s already saying filaments are in stock when I know for a fact they are currently out of stock.
-If I add suppliers to the suppliers list and then attempt to edit a filament and add said supplier the supplier list is blank. I’m forced to delete the filament and add it again to add a supplier.

Has Potential - Updated

This app has potential, but the fact that there is not a way to type in numbers just ruins the whole app. I wanted something simple without any frills to keep track of my filament and this app fit the bill. But if I want to put in an exact weight of my filament left I have to change the step count to 1 and press the arrows up or down how ever many times to get to the right number. Just give it a keyboard so I can type the numbers and this app would have the potential to be perfect. - The developer has since updated the app so I wanted to update my review. Since adding the ability to adjust the filament amount by using the number pad this app got way better. I now changed my increment to 1000 and just tap that whenever I buy a new spool, which makes it super simple. After a print is completed I just subtract it from my spool using the number pad. The only thing that does not work is the barcode scanner which could be useful but does not bother me, so I am updating to 5 stars!
